What is Secondary Glazing?

Secondary glazing describes the addition of a 2nd layer of glazing-- usually a transparent sheet of glass or plastic-- positioned inside or beyond an existing window. This additional layer functions as a barrier to sound while likewise enhancing thermal insulation. Secondary glazing is particularly popular in older residential or Commercial Secondary Glazing properties where replacing initial single-glazed windows may not be feasible or desirable for visual factors.

How Secondary Glazing Reduces Noise

Secondary glazing decreases noise through two main systems:

  1. Increased Air Gap: By creating an air area between the 2 layers of glazing, Secondary Glazing Noise Reduction glazing improves sound insulation. The air space acts as a buffer, soaking up sound waves before they can pass through to the interior space.

  2. Damping Effect: Secondary glazing adds mass to the window system. The combination of mass and the air gap helps to dampen sound vibrations, causing more noise attenuation.

Efficiency of Different Glazing Materials

The effectiveness of secondary glazing in reducing noise mainly depends on the materials and thickness of the glazing utilized. Below is a table summing up the noise reduction capabilities of various glazing types:

Glazing TypeNormal ThicknessSTC Rating *Noise Reduction Capability
Single Glass4-6 mm28-32 dBLow
Laminated Glass6-12 mm32-38 dBModerate
Double Glazing12-24 mm34-42 dBExcellent
Triple Glazing24-30 mm38-45 dBExcellent
Acrylic/Perspex3-5 mm25-30 dBLow to Moderate

* STC = Sound Transmission Class: A higher STC score indicates higher noise insulation capabilities.

Installation Considerations

Successfully executing secondary glazing involves a couple of important factors to consider:

  1. Choosing the Right Materials: Opt for top quality materials that satisfy your noise reduction requirements. Laminated and double-glazed options are frequently the very best for sound insulation.

  2. Professional Installation: While secondary glazing can in some cases be a DIY project, enlisting professional help ensures proper installation and maximizes noise reduction efforts.

  3. Frame Type: Consider the kind of frame used for secondary glazing. Options like uPVC, timber, or aluminum effect not only aesthetics however likewise general noise insulation.

  4. Air Gap Size: The performance of Secondary Glazing Maintenance Tips glazing increases with the width of the air space. A space of 100mm or more is ideal for attaining optimum noise reduction.

  5. Sealing: Ensure all edges and joints are well-sealed to avoid sound infiltration. Premium seals can substantially improve the overall efficiency.
